Understanding the Music: Tosca

More details

In this lecture, you’ll hear about how Puccini combined long-breathed romantic arias with modern verismo style, creating a soundscape of early 19th-century Rome in Tosca (1900). Presented by Colette Simonot-Maiello, Associate Professor of Musicology and Associate Dean at the Desautels Faculty of Music.
